The age of agree of them all

Into the 2013 the prime Minister David Cameron declined calls to lower the age of sexual concur and no societal debate, stating that ages of 16 was at spot to include pupils. Those who have named to reduce age sexual concur enjoys focused alternatively on declining period of puberty and/or �real’ ages where girls and boys engage in ostensibly consensual intimate serves with their peers. Even with tend to are pitted against each other, this type of additional viewpoints aren’t collectively exclusive. Rather, he or she is inserted inside the distinctive line of understandings away from intimate concur laws and the purpose. Very, usually, just what might have been this new understood reason for the female chronilogical age of agree? Over the years new imagined purpose of sexual agree legislation has changed. These changes, and you may differences between for tinder or plenty of fish the past and give concept of �sexual consent’, must be approved in this one conversation regarding modifying what the law states. Plan brands will not be able to move give until it avoid and work out head evaluations with the 1885 legislation versus accepting their at some point different goal.

Within the Roman law and you may cannon rules age females agree are aligned having women wedding and with puberty (particularly the capability to reproduce). Maturity and you may wedding try expected to can be found regarding the age 12 for women, though in very early incarnations the judge age of consent is actually versatile according to relationship preparations. Agree by itself was not the main focus ones legislation, in which a people’s directly to just take a girl’s chastity � ideally, but not always, with her agree � included marriage. Inside the 1576 an alternative rules made sexual intercourse that have girls lower than the age of ten a felony if you find yourself leaving offences facing ladies aged ten-12 as a good misdemeanour. Which operate implicitly written a-two-tiered program, where the higher sentences had been kepted for offences contrary to the youngest women.

New thirteenth-millennium Statutes regarding Westminster consolidated in law one to intercourse having a lady �in this age’ � taken to imply under the relationship ages of several � was unlawful having otherwise in place of the girl consent

By the nineteenth millennium the average age marriage had increased on middle-20s, when you’re changing conceptions away from youthfulness including created that the �child’ is actually laid out much more during the societal and you may economic conditions also as in relation to readiness and relationship condition. Change in order to age of concur legislation on the nineteenth millennium try likely with these changing suggestions regarding young people and, the very first time, framed within the son safeguards terminology. Yet not, Victorian lawmakers had been together with very worried about problems (along with disorderly sexualities). Throughout the absence of a primary transition of youth so you’re able to wedding, the age of consent along with constituted a type of control over females chastity in the a seemingly hazardous life phase. Overall, backlinks between sexual concur, matrimony and you can puberty � and therefore formed the cornerstone from very early laws and regulations � poor over the years.
